Why do some people achieve extraordinary results while others, who are just as talented, fall short?

In her acclaimed, multi-million-copy bestseller, Grit, award-winning psychologist Angela Duckworth takes us on an eye-opening journey to discover the true qualities that lead to success.

Using case studies from her own childhood upbringing to her extensive research studying the psychology of success in sports and business, Duckworth reveals that talent is not what makes humans more likely to succeed. Instead, it’s a powerful combination of passion and perseverance – what she calls ‘grit’.

Drawing on cutting-edge research and real-world stories, Grit reveals:

  • What ‘grit’ is and why it matters
  • How grit can be learned, regardless of IQ or circumstances
  • Why stubbornness is a key characteristic of gritty people
  • How to develop lifelong purpose and passion

Personal, powerful and empowering, Grit is the inspiring and practical guide that will show you how to develop the resilience, focus and determination needed to succeed.

About the author

Angela Duckworth

Angela Duckworth, PhD, is a psychologist, a MacArthur Fellow, and the Rosa Lee and Egbert Chang Professor at the University of Pennsylvania. Duckworth’s TED talk is among the most viewed of all time. Her book Grit: The Power of Passion and Perseverance was a #1 New York Times bestseller and has sold more than 5 million copies worldwide.
